Expert Review
This part-time position at UnitedHealth Group provides a solid entry point into pharmacy operations. Unlike many retail roles, it requires an active Texas Pharmacy Technician license, ensuring that candidates are qualified from the start. The company emphasizes compliance with rigorous state and federal regulations, which can be a steep learning curve for new technicians.
Expect a demanding work atmosphere where you’ll assist the Pharmacist with various tasks. While the role is flexible, the fast-paced nature may lead to long shifts, which won't suit everyone. Applicants should also note that specific salary information is not disclosed, potentially impacting financial planning.
Customer service is a vital part of this job. The quality of interaction with customers can greatly affect job satisfaction. Those who thrive in high-pressure situations and enjoy direct patient contact will likely find this role fulfilling.
Prospective employees should be ready for a competitive application process given the high demand for pharmacy technicians in Texas.
